Description

  • Own the strategy and roadmap for customer-facing platform capabilities.
  • Define outcome-based priorities and make tradeoffs aligned with business objectives.
  • Communicate the rationale behind roadmap decisions to internal stakeholders.
  • Champion enterprise readiness across configuration, maintenance, and guardrail design.
  • Identify and prioritize governance, compliance, and tenant administration capabilities for large enterprise customers.
  • Engage directly with CIOs, CISOs, IT leaders, and tenant administrators to understand enterprise requirements.
  • Partner with field teams to validate platform capabilities and represent Seeq’s enterprise direction.
  • Work with design and engineering to deliver secure, scalable, and operationally sound platform capabilities.
  • Champion reliability, performance, and the administrative experience for enterprise users.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in B2B SaaS product management.
  • Experience delivering platform, infrastructure, or data products for enterprise teams and administrators.
  • Experience with enterprise platform concerns such as multi-tenancy, user and role management, data connectors and integrations, and cloud infrastructure (AWS, Azure) is highly valued.
  • Experience building and communicating outcome-based roadmaps with a clear explanation of the business impact.
  • Fluency in using data to drive decisions, including defining metrics, running experiments, analyzing usage, and course correcting based on evidence.
  • Practical AI literacy, including experience designing AI-powered product experiences and using AI in PM workflows.
  • Track record of succeeding in ambiguous, fast-evolving environments such as startups, scale-ups, or zero-to-one product areas.
  • Strong strategic thinking and the ability to connect customer needs, market dynamics, and business goals into an investment point of view.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ills for aligning engineers, executives, and customers.
  • Bachelor’s or master’s degree in engineering, computer science, or a related field is a plus.
  • Experience in process manufacturing, industrial software, or data analytics is a plus.
  • Willingness to travel occasionally for customer visits, conferences, and team events.
